Weihenstephan
Suburb
Photo: Violatan, Copyrighted free use.
Weihenstephan is a part of Freising north of Munich, Germany. It is located on the Weihenstephan Hill, named after the Weihenstephan Abbey, in the west of the city. Weihenstephan is known for:…
